Virginia Tech in shambles
In light of recent events at Virginia Tech, Chabot College is in the process of adding more emphasis on unexpected campus emergencies and incorporating response into the school's disaster plan. Virginia Technical University experienced Monday the worst school shooting massacre in United States history, leaving 33 people dead, and 15 injured.

Earth Day expanded

Local colleges and universitys take Earth Day further by making it a week long celebration

By Alexis Daniel

More than 30 years ago, a man by the name of John McConnell founded the first Earth Day celebration. The International Earth Day festivities are meant to take place during the spring equinox, which symbolizes rebirth and renewal on March 20. Nationwide, it is celebrated on April 22; it is a secular holiday, observed mostly in English-speaking countries.
